Vietnam’s exports to US accelerate

Vietnam’s exports to the U.S. surged 24.4% year-on-year to $66.09 billion in the first seven months, the highest growth rate among its export markets. In the seven-month period, American buyers spent a monthly average of close to $9.6 billion on purchasing goods from Vietnamese suppliers. Sumitomo Electric Industries to invest $27 mln more in Hanoi to make flexible circuit boards

Sumitomo Electric Industries (SEI), under Japanese keiretsu Sumitomo, will invest an additional $27.4 million in two projects for manufacturing flexible circuit boards in the capital city of Hanoi. Rice exports forecast to hit record-high $5B this year

Rice exports could generate a record US$5 billion this year if the current pace of shipment is maintained, a rice exporter has forecast. Chinese battery maker Sunwoda plans $300 mln additional investment in northern Vietnam

Sunwoda, a leading Chinese battery firm, plans to invest an additional $300 million at the Yen Lu Industrial Park in the northern province of Bac Giang.
